As to the Issues, here they are:
Issue Number Brief Description Resolution
--------------------------------------------------------------------------
19 IANA Considerations Eliot to propose text.
27 How long is a day? No resolution yet. This
has to do with DST transitions.
36 Section 4.1 use of X-Name Consensus to drop "bilateral"
and encourage use of IANA
and to add some BCP text.
42 4.6.6 Alarm component restrict. Consensus: remove restriction.
47 4.8.6.3 trigger relative to DATE Prefer configured timezone.
Fall back to UTC.
55 Remove SECONDLY, MINUTELY, Nuke BYSEC and SECONDLY.
BYSEC and BYMIN Also nuke MINUTELY. This
leaves open the question
of BYMINUTE.
